The cyclists of the STIHL Tour des Trees faced the most challenging terrain of the 2011 Tour today: 65 miles of Skyline Drive (and that was AFTER the 12-mile ascent to the park). The weather has been beautiful, the scenery is spectacular, and the riders were primed for the challenge. They’ve spent the summer training for the ride and fundraising for the TREE Fund, but this week their focus is 100% on riding.
